Understand My Training
Over time, I became someone who wanted to understand why I was doing a session and what it was meant to achieve. Asking those questions helped me learn from the different coaches I trained with.
I also studied how David Rudisha trained. In my notes, I singled out the emphasis on drills, the hilly environment, altitude, the number of sessions, and relatively little weight training. Those were things that caught my attention while studying his training.
Wanting to become faster kept revealing more areas I could work on. Reading Relax and Win brought relaxation into that picture too.
